THRESHING, verb. Present participle of thresh
THRESHING, noun. The act by which something is threshed.
THRESHING FLOOR, noun. The floor of a threshing house or similar area where grain is threshed.

THRESHING, noun. The separation of grain or seeds from the husks and straw; "they used to do the threshing by hand but now there are machines to do it".
